Product Review: Time Defiance Age Defying Skin Care System

Skin Care

Recently, a reader asked me to review Artistry ® Time Defiance ® skin care ($199.00, The company claims that the three-part skin care system is be able to “defy age beyond procedures.” If the claim sounds a little far-fetched, it is, for there is no way that the concentrations of active ingredients in this Read more »